Output 52f621bb919dd5cd9e51dbdd7b18046679228f3adb96f7b1285b9ccdfc8a2e7e:0

value
212761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27873a91ebc8aaf5943c097f23bcc7546ecb1ea7 OP_EQUAL
address
35J2GtMBSbjLWoq5NkTgt6FePb2xNea3hg
transaction
52f621bb919dd5cd9e51dbdd7b18046679228f3adb96f7b1285b9ccdfc8a2e7e
spent
true